    Line of sight is broken

    Characters position are not represented accurately to other players. This is by far my biggest frustration with the game at this point. Some examples:

    1. All I can see of an enemy is their shoulder, based on the visual feedback the game is giving me, they can not see me. I take a few seconds to line up a shot, and in that time they've killed me, when it should be impossible (based on the visual feedback)

    2. When player's are lying prone on ramps and stairs, all I can see is a few inches of the top of their head, its should be impossible for them to see me, let alone fire a gun at me. Yet this is what happens.

    3. When I'm lying prone, and can just make out the lower half of an enemy unser some obstacles, they should not be able to see me. Same issue, I think I have time to line up the shot, but against what is physically possible, they can see me.

    I really want to see this bug addressed, as it can kill a lot of the fun for me.

    I think you are talking about stair/ramp glitching, not the more general "line of sight" bugs. The two are related for sure, but this game has a line of sight bug that can affect you around any obstacle with your character in any stance. The only way to avoid these is to stand in the open at all times. In simple terms, a players position/view is not always accurately portrayed to the other players. This is true when they are prone on a ramp, but also true when standing behind a crate.
